Suez Canal - Transit

Vessel arrived of Port Said on Friday 1st Februart 2008,
After anchoring to await our turn to proceed in, we eventually
arrived in the harbour at 1.ooam the following day.
Once we had cleared immigration and customs (at much cost to the
onboard cigarette locker!!), we eventually joined our convoy at 3.30am.
Due to it being night time, not many photos could be taken. So the
following photo's are when the vessel was at anchor in the Bitter Lake,
which looked more like a ships version of NCP car parks!! Due to a
container ship running aground and blocking one channel.....


That is the culprit, circled. Better not give out the name of the vessel.









Unfortunetly due to the fact that the ship has run aground, the rest of
the transit will be done in darkness. So that is all to see in the Suez Canal....
